Differentiation from first principles derives the gradient function from the limit definition, f′(x) = lim(h→0)[f(x+h) − f(x)]/h, showing where the rules of differentiation come from. It's a key topic in A-Level and International A-Level (iAL) Pure Mathematics. How you do it

Write the gradient of the chord as f of x plus h minus f of x, all over h. Expand the numerator, cancel the h that divides through every term, then let h tend to zero in what is left. Cancelling before taking the limit is the step that makes it work.
